网络协议,构建互联网世界的基石

guo 网站优化 60

本文目录导读:

  1. 什么是网络协议?
  2. 网络协议的分类
  3. 网络协议的应用
  4. 网络协议的发展趋势

随着互联网的飞速发展,我们的生活已经离不开网络,而网络协议作为互联网世界的基石,承载着信息传递、数据交换和系统通信等重要功能,本文将带您走进网络协议的世界,了解其背后的原理和应用。

什么是网络协议?

网络协议是计算机网络中进行数据交换的规则和标准,它规定了数据传输的格式、传输顺序、错误处理和安全性等方面的内容,网络协议使得不同类型的计算机、设备和网络之间能够相互通信,实现信息的共享和传递。

网络协议的分类

1、物理层协议

物理层协议负责数据的传输介质,如双绞线、光纤等,常见的物理层协议有以太网(Ethernet)、光纤分布式数据接口(FDDI)等。

2、数据链路层协议

数据链路层协议负责在相邻节点之间建立、维护和终止数据链路,常见的协议有以太网帧(Ethernet Frame)、点对点协议(PPP)等。

3、网络层协议

网络层协议负责数据包的路由和转发,常见的协议有互联网协议(IP)、互联网控制消息协议(ICMP)、地址解析协议(ARP)等。

4、传输层协议

传输层协议负责提供端到端的数据传输服务,确保数据可靠、有序地到达目的地,常见的协议有传输控制协议(TCP)、用户数据报协议(UDP)等。

5、应用层协议

应用层协议负责为用户提供各种网络服务,如文件传输、电子邮件、网页浏览等,常见的协议有超文本传输协议(HTTP)、简单邮件传输协议(SMTP)、文件传输协议(FTP)等。

网络协议的应用

1、互联网通信

网络协议是互联网通信的基础,使得全球范围内的计算机、设备和网络能够相互连接,实现信息的共享和传递。

2、网络设备互联

网络协议使得不同厂商、不同型号的网络设备能够相互兼容,实现网络的互联互通。

3、网络安全

网络协议在数据传输过程中,通过加密、认证等手段,保障数据的安全性和完整性。

4、网络管理

网络协议在网络管理中发挥着重要作用,如故障诊断、性能监控、流量控制等。

网络协议的发展趋势

1、网络协议的智能化

随着人工智能技术的发展,网络协议将更加智能化,能够自动适应网络环境的变化,提高网络性能。

2、网络协议的融合

未来网络协议将更加融合,实现不同层级的协议协同工作,提高网络效率。

3、网络协议的绿色化

随着环保意识的提高,网络协议将更加注重节能降耗,降低网络能耗。

网络协议是构建互联网世界的基石,它承载着信息传递、数据交换和系统通信等重要功能,随着互联网的不断发展,网络协议将不断演进,为我们的生活带来更多便利。

抱歉,评论功能暂时关闭!